Impact evaluation of Gram Varta

Impact evaluation of Gram Varta

Gram Varta is a Community Mobilization initiative using Participatory Learning and Action Approaches with SHG’s (SWASTH Project). The University of Göttingen received a grant from the International Initiative for Impact Evaluation to evaluate Gram Varta. MORSEL was selected as a sub-contractor by the University of Göttingen to survey 4000 households (household heads and women separately), around 2600 adolescent girls and 2000 pregnant women in 184 GPs of Madhepura district of Bihar. MORSEL also collected anthropometric data of Households and hemoglobin level of all members of 4000 households and 2000 pregnant women and their husbands. MORSEL also tested the presence of E Coli in the stored drinking water of 4000 households and the presence of parasites in the stool of kids below 5 years in the selected households

Location: Madhepura district of Bihar
